What is Slime?

Slime, a non-Newtonian fluid, exhibits peculiar properties that make it both solid and liquid-like. It is typically made by combining a polymer, such as polyvinyl alcohol (PVA), with water and a cross-linking agent, such as borax. The polymer chains entangle, forming a network that traps water molecules and gives slime its unique consistency.
